ABQ Water Introduces Self-Service Payment Kiosk with Bernalillo County

Albuquerque Bernalillo County Water Utility Authority recently launched a new self-service payment option for their customers downtown, through an engagement with CityBase. Water Authority customers can now pay their water and sewer bills at a new, self-service kiosk in the lobby of the Bernalillo County @ Alvarado Square at 415 Silver Ave SW.

This partnership provides the only in-person payment option in downtown Albuquerque for Water Authority customers. 

The payment kiosk provides a free, secure, and convenient way for customers to pay their utility bills using cash, check, and card. The kiosk provides service in English and Spanish. Water Authority customers who use the new payment kiosk can look up their current balance using their account number, and make a full or partial payment without incurring any fees. A simple payment workflow is easy to understand and takes under a minute on average to complete a transaction. 

The Water Authority provides water and wastewater services to the greater Albuquerque metropolitan area. It is the largest water and wastewater utility in New Mexico.

The Water Authority procured the technology by leveraging CityBase’s contract with the Allied States Cooperative, a national purchasing cooperative that competitively awards contracts to U.S. vendors in compliance with local, state, and federal procurement laws and regulations.
